The Wolf Point Wolves put up a good fight before falling to Malta in four sets at the District 2B volleyball tournament on Saturday, Oct. 30. The Wolves placed third in the tournament and will compete at the divisional tournament in Glasgow starting on Thursday, Nov. 4. The Froid/Lake Red Hawks won three straight matches on Saturday, Oct. 30, to earn second place at the District 1C volleyball tournament held in Scobey. The Red Hawks downed North Country, 25-27, 25-13, 19-25, 25-16, 15-8, in the second- place match on Saturday afternoon. Down by two sets to one, the Red Hawks gained an 1811 lead in the fourth set on kills by Dasani Nesbit and Baylee Davidson.

The Lady Wolves edged Harlem in five sets during the District 2B volleyball tournament in Wolf Point on Friday, Oct. 29. Wolf Point scored a 14-25, 25-15, 23-25, 25-22, 15-9, victory. The Wolf Point Wolves earned a divisional berth by knocking off Poplar in straight sets during the District 2B volleyball tournament in Wolf Point on Friday, Oct. 29. The Wolves captured a 251, 25-12, 25-18, opening-round victory. After kills by Sierra Hamilton led the Wolves to a quick 3-0 lead in the first set, Poplar scored on a kill by Kylie Gourneau. Culbertson’s dream football season came to an end when the Cowboys lost to Belt, 36-15, in the first round of the Class C state playoffs in Culbertson on Saturday, Oct. 30. The Cowboys, who didn’t win a single game last year, entered the contest as the second seed from the Eastern C. The Lady Wolves struggled and lost to top-seeded Glasgow in straight sets at the District 2B volleyball tournament in Wolf Point on Friday, Oct. 29. Glasgow took the match by a 25-14, 25-11, 25-19, final. Wolf Point started out in strong fashion as kills by Jaylee Azure and Sierra Hamilton led the way to a 5-1 advantage. The Culbertson Cowgirls spent the night battling back before nipping Scobey in five sets during the opening round of the District 1C volleyball tournament in Scobey on Thursday, Oct. 28. Culbertson came away with an 18-25, 23-25, 25-20, 2521, 15-13, victory. Ahead by only an 18-17 margin in the fourth set, the Cowgirls used a block and a back-row kill by Makena Hauge to move ahead 22-17.
